Transaction 53bb23421a043917551eae67f6ccb2fcdde74ec2f044c16ad465ef5f7254b802
1 Input
1 Output
-
53bb23421a043917551eae67f6ccb2fcdde74ec2f044c16ad465ef5f7254b802:0
- value
- 271743
- script pubkey
- OP_0 OP_PUSHBYTES_20 afe16609cbe35d4e018f3bdfb40964cc7c9384ef
- address
- bc1q4lskvzwtudw5uqv0800mgztye37f8p80rv4q4g